Output ab066028bdb0778357ccf829592193b8b482cc7e34f7c9dbd4b53d1f0ee42aef:3

value
572199825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fbfead3a84990ece3e68368957d57f6c8e2de61 OP_EQUALVERIFY OP_CHECKSIG
address
13tsrbT8BusYyhAKUYCfPrjXadYGuEq3g4
transaction
ab066028bdb0778357ccf829592193b8b482cc7e34f7c9dbd4b53d1f0ee42aef
spent
true